The DT Swiss 350 Straight Pull CenterLock hubs strike a balance between durability, serviceability, and value for gravel and cyclocross riders, offering straight-pull spoke compatibility and DT’s proven ratchet engagement for reliable on-trail performance. They are a cost-effective workhorse compared with the pricier, boutique options on this list—easier and cheaper to maintain than premium sealed-bearing hubs like Chris King and lighter and more affordable than many Industry Nine builds. For riders building robust gravel wheels who prioritize parts availability and low lifetime cost over boutique finishes or ultra-high engagement, the 350 is the pragmatic choice.

Hope Pro 5 thru-axle hubs are known for rugged, user-serviceable engineering and a strong value proposition for cyclocross and gravel use, combining high durability and straightforward pawl serviceability at a mid-range price. They typically offer more user-friendly field serviceability than sealed-bearing premium hubs and present a lower price point than Chris King and Industry Nine while delivering comparable braking rotor options and reliable engagement for rough conditions. For riders who want a tough, home-servicable hub that can take hard use without the premium cost of boutique alternatives, the Pro 5 is a dependable pick.

Chris King R45D Disc hubs are the premium, durability-first choice for gravel and cyclocross riders who prioritize long-term serviceability, ultra-precise bearings and tight manufacturing tolerances that yield exceptional reliability and resale value. While they carry a higher upfront cost than the other hubs listed, their longevity, proprietary sealing and rebuildability often make them the most economical over many seasons compared with lower-cost hubs that require more frequent replacement or servicing. For riders and builders who want a lifetime-quality hub and are willing to pay a premium for top-tier engineering and serviceability, the R45D sits at the top of the market.

Why thru axle gravel hubs work: research and practical evidence

Engineering tests and field evaluations from independent reviewers and industry labs consistently show that thru axle hub designs, good seals and tubeless-ready interfaces produce measurable benefits for mixed-terrain cyclists. The main advantages are improved lateral stiffness and predictable handling from a secured axle interface, reduced rolling resistance and fewer pinch flats with tubeless systems, and longer bearing life when contamination is minimized by quality seals. These outcomes are supported by laboratory stiffness and durability testing, industry performance reviews, and many rider field tests that compare hubs, wheel builds and tubeless setups under real-world conditions.

Axle interface and stiffness: Independent wheel and frame tests show thru axles reduce lateral flex versus traditional quick-release systems, improving steering precision and cornering confidence—beneficial on loose gravel and uneven cyclocross courses.

Tubeless and wider rims: Rolling resistance and puncture performance tests from industry reviewers indicate tubeless setups on wider rims lower the chance of pinch flats and allow lower pressures for better traction and comfort on mixed terrain.

Sealing and bearing longevity: Laboratory contamination trials and service data from hub manufacturers demonstrate that effective seal designs and proper grease significantly extend bearing life and reduce service frequency in wet, muddy American conditions.

Engagement and maintenance trade-offs: High-engagement hubs offer faster re-engagement under load useful for technical riding, but independent serviceability tests highlight that simple, well-documented hub internals make long-term ownership easier in regions with limited local service.

Materials and finishing: Corrosion-resistant treatments and quality anodizing or stainless hardware improve longevity in road salt and wet climates common across the USA, as confirmed by corrosion testing and long-term user reports.
